Descripción general

Lapatinib, utilizado en forma de ditosilato de lapatinib, es un potente inhibidor de EGFR y ErbB2 con IC50 de 10,8 y 9,2 nM, respectivamente.
Es un agente antineoplásico utilizado en la investigación del cáncer de mama

Mecanismos bioquímicos y fisiológicos
El lapatinib es un agente antineoplásico utilizado en la investigación del cáncer de mama. Parece ser un inhibidor de la tirosina quinasa que interrumpe las vías Neu/ ErbB2 y EGFR (receptor del factor de crecimiento epidérmico), inhibiendo así los tumores

Nota
Siempre que sea posible, prepare y utilice las soluciones el mismo día. No obstante, si necesita preparar soluciones madre con antelación, le recomendamos que almacene la solución como alícuotas en viales herméticamente cerrados a -20°C. Por lo general, podrán utilizarse durante un mes. Antes de su uso, y antes de abrir el vial, le recomendamos que deje que el producto se equilibre a temperatura ambiente durante al menos 1 hora. ¿Necesita más consejos sobre solubilidad, uso y manipulación? Propiedades químicas y físicas
SolubilidadDMSO 100 mg/mL (172.09 mM); Water <1 mg/mL (<1 mM); Ethanol <1 mg/mL (<1 mM)
SensibilidadAir Sensitive,Heat Sensitive
Punto de fusión (°C)147 °C
